Identify Your Safe Model and Serial Number
Before you call anybody, you need to know exactly what you're working with. Viking makes a variety of safes, through small jewelry containers to large long-gun safes. The majority of their own modern units are biometric or digital, but they generally come with the physical override key for emergencies.
You'll need the serial number from the safe. This is the particular "golden ticket" intended for getting a viking safe key replacement . Usually, you could find this particular number on the small silver or dark sticker on the back again of the safe or sometimes on the side near the bottom part. If you've attached your safe to the wall or even floor (which a person should have! ), this may be the bit of a workout. You might need a reflection plus a flashlight to see the back again.
Write that number down carefully. Each digit matters. Whilst you're at this, note the model number too. Having this info ready will make the particular conversation with the manufacturer or a locksmith go a lot smoother.
Experiencing the Manufacturer
Probably the most straightforward way to handle a viking safe key replacement is in order to go straight to the particular source. Viking Protection Safe has the specific protocol with regard to this, mostly mainly because they take security seriously. They aren't just going to mail a key to anyone which calls and states they own a safe.
Generally, you'll need to fill up out a key request form. They will likely ask intended for: * The serial variety of the safe. * A image of your IDENTITY. * Proof associated with purchase (if you have it). * A notarized statement of ownership.
The notarized part sounds like a pain, but it's presently there to protect a person. You wouldn't want a thief in order to be able in order to order a key to your safe just by reading through a number off the particular back from it. Once you submit the particular paperwork and pay out the fee, usually it takes anywhere from the few days to a couple of weeks to get the particular key in the particular mail.

What If the particular Key is Broken?
It's a nightmare scenario: a person have the key, but it snaps off right within the lock. When this happens while you're trying to get a viking safe key replacement , don't try in order to dig it out there having a screwdriver. You'll just push the particular broken piece deeper.
A locksmith has specialized "key extractors" that may slide in following to the damaged bit and draw it out. When the broken piece has gone out, they can usually make use of the two halves of the broken key to cut a brand-new one. It's in fact easier for a locksmith to create a key when they possess the broken pieces compared to when they have almost nothing.
How Much Would it Really Cost?
Expenses can vary extremely. If you proceed through the manufacturer for a viking safe key replacement , you're usually looking at approximately $30 and $60, in addition shipping. It's the particular cheapest option, however it requires the nearly all patience.
If you bring in a locksmith, the price gets. A service contact alone might be $75 to $150, as well as the labor regarding generating a key from scratch can add another $100 or even more. If the safe has to be drilled (hopefully not! ), you will be looking at a number of hundred dollars. This particular is why monitoring those spare keys is so essential!
